A repack is a modified installer of a software program. Typically, third-party developers or crackers take the original software files, bypass the registration or licensing system (often by injecting a crack or keygen), and compress the files into a new installer.

The most significant and immediate danger of using a cracked repack is malware. Hackers frequently embed malicious code inside these repacks to infect your computer. Because the software comes from an unknown, untrusted source, you have no idea what else is being installed on your machine alongside the program.
